Our Fall Fundraising Event, “The Restoration Dinner: Building a Pathway Home,” will take place on September 11, 2026, from 5:30pm to 8:00pm at Edgewater Fellowship in Grants Pass, with doors opening at 5:00pm. It will be an encouraging evening featuring a wonderful dinner, uplifting live music by the Mercy Duo, and deeply moving personal testimonies from residents whose lives are being transformed by Christ. We will also share vital updates on our MissionView Village project, an affordable 55+ community designed to restore housing dignity to our local older adults. Because this is our premier fundraising event of the season, the evening will culminate in a direct ask for funding and an exciting, auction-style “paddle raise.”
